Description

  • CARLO BUGATTI
  • "Sgabello" Side Chair
  • walnut, ebonized walnut, copper and pewter

Provenance

Sotheby's London, October 23, 1987, lot 393
Acquired from the above by the present owner

Literature

Philippe Dejean, Carlo-Rembrandt-Ettore-Jean Bugatti, Paris, 1981, p. 53
Die Bugattis, exh. cat., Museum für Kunst und Gewerbe Hamburg, Hamburg, 1983, p. 103
Henry H. Hawley, Bugatti, exh. cat., The Cleveland Museum of Art, Cleveland, 1999, p. 15
Marie-Madeleine Massé, Carlo Bugatti au Musée d’Orsay, Paris, 2001, pp. 48, no. 4.20, 71, no. 6.28 and 96, no. 8.41

Condition

Overall in very good condition. The chair has recently been sensitively stabilized by a leading conservator and the metal inlays are all stable. The surfaces present with a few surfaces, minor abrasions, a few discolorations and light surface soiling consistent with age and gentle use. The wood with a few minor edge abrasions along the legs, very few, old and stable worm holes and a few minor and stable cracks to the wood. The underside of the seat with a small element which has been stabilized at the back at some point in the history of the chair, stable. The chair is solid and sturdy. The chair with a small area of losses to the inlays at the center of the front of the seat edge, and another small loss to the proper left side of the front of the base, not visually distracting to the overall design. The metal surfaces with minor discoloration and surface scratches consistent with gentle use. Overall a very good example of a classic design by Bugatti, from the Jacqueline Fowler collection.
